The Third Annual Cancer Survivorship Telephone Education Workshop Series: Living With, Through & Beyond Cancer

This free telephone education workshop series offers cancer survivors and their loved ones practical information to help them deal with concerns and issues that arise after treatment ends. The information discussed during these calls is designed primarily for cancer survivors who have recently completed their cancer treatment, but may also be helpful for those who were treated a long time ago, as well as healthcare professionals.

Part I: Care & Wellbeing After Treatment

Tuesday, April 12, 2005

Part II: Managing Longterm Lingering Side Effects

Tuesday, May 24, 2005

Part III: Health Promoting Behaviors: Things You Can Do

Tuesday, June 14, 2005


This program is a collaborative effort between CancerCare, the Lance Armstrong Foundation, the National Cancer Institute, the Intercultural Cancer Council, Living Beyond Breast Cancer and the National Coalition for Cancer Survivorship.
